如何压缩变量? - 技术问答
比如说有一个变量: $str = \"aaaaaa\";入数据库之前:我想通过一个压缩函数(假设叫做\"zip()\"吧)$str_zip = zip($str);将其压缩。需要用的时候:再通过一个解压缩函数(假设叫做\"unzip()\"吧)$str = unzip($str_zip );我看了php文档,发现gzip函数怎么都是对文件的操作啊。哪位大侠知道,我先谢谢了。我的数据库需要保存大量的html代码,每条记录大概32K左右,共有6万条记录。单表空间已经达到1.7GB了。所以我需要这个功能。另外,我并没有选择最佳答案,怎么论坛帮我自动选择了?多谢“yafeikf ”,LZF compression 正满足我的需要,哈哈!
答案:对与大字符串而言,文件就是一个字符串。。。。当然了,很多时候没有压缩的必要,因为解压还要花费时间。。。
到技术吧网站查看回答详情>>6402
lzf_compress/lzf_decompress会不会更好一点.?yafeikf 发表于 2009-4-20 19:04[i][/url][/b]这个不错,确实能够满足我的需要。但是官方只提供了源代码,没有提供dll文件下载。您能否给小弟发一份dll版的?
到技术吧网站查看回答详情>>很黄很暴力。。。??都没听说过变量可以zip
到技术吧网站查看回答详情>>变量不可压缩,你说的应该是字符串吧。字符串可以用加密的方法压缩,但不一定保证会变小,也许会“压大”
到技术吧网站查看回答详情>>偶孤陋寡闻。。。。。用过COMPRESS/UNCOMPRESS,没见过怎么压缩变量的.....
到技术吧网站查看回答详情>>lzf_compress/lzf_decompress会不会更好一点.?
到技术吧网站查看回答详情>>
上一个:求解自定义函数库里面的函数是否可以覆盖全局函数
下一个:C#如何调用自定义函数